Miller Industries is seeking a CNC Machine Operator for our SHC Athens, Tennessee facility. You will set up and operate CNC machines, read blueprints, and use precision measurement tools to ensure parts meet specifications.
Join our Machine Shop team on the night shift, with responsibilities including loading materials, verifying dimensions, and adjusting processes for quality. Requires basic math and hands-on machining experience.
Miller Industries is seeking to fill the position of CNC Machine Operator. This position is based in our SHC Athens, Tennessee manufacturing facility, and is a part of our Machine Shop department. Operator may set up and operate various CNC machines as company needs require.
Set up and operate fabricating machines such as brakes, drill presses, lasers, lathes, and mills.
